If your access to the Pipwick metrics sidecar admin console gets wedged (happens more than we'd like), don't panic. First try re-issuing your token from the Fernhollow gateway; if that fails, use the break-glass account recovery flow in the sidecar's local CLI. That flow will prompt you for the team recovery passphrase, which is listed below.

strongbox words: gilok-druion-briath-wendor-briion-prawyn-fenion-oliir-casdor-holius-briius-gilath-gilael-pelys

## Formula sandbox tuning

User-supplied formulas in Gridmoor execute inside a restricted interpreter with hard ceilings on time, memory, and call depth. Reviewers should confirm any change to these ceilings is justified in the PR description, since raising them widens the abuse surface. Defaults were chosen from production traces. The current limits are as follows.

limits module of tafog-fawip:
WEIGHTS = {
    "julix": 57,
    "lamys": 992,
    "kasvan": 209,
    "quenok": 750,
    "alddor": 259,
    "oliath": 1009,
    "wenix": 815,
}

## Runbook: Account Recovery — Spinshelf Locker Access

If a resident's locker account is locked out after repeated failed badge scans, the Spinshelf gateway quarantines the account for thirty minutes. Do not wait out the timer during peak hours. Instead, verify the resident's unit number against the tenancy record, clear the quarantine flag from the ops console, and re-issue a one-time unlock token. If the console itself rejects your session, escalate to recovery mode, which authenticates with the passphrase provided below.

unlock words, yawig-kagef: gordor-holvan-ulaael-pramir-ulaiel-tamdor